Key points of interest

Nemrut Krater Gölü (Nemrut Caldera Lake & Twin Lakes)
Nemrut Krater Gölü (Nemrut Caldera Lake & Twin Lakes)
Europe's second-largest volcanic crater caldera containing stunning twin hot and cold lakes and panoramic viewpoints.
Van Gölü & Tatvan Lakeside Promenade
Van Gölü & Tatvan Lakeside Promenade
Stunning blue soda lake shore offering ferry ports, waterside dining, and beach promenades.
Tatvan Historic Railway Ferry Terminal
Tatvan Historic Railway Ferry Terminal
Major trans-Asian railway ferry terminus linking the Turkish rail network across Lake Van toward Iran.

History & cultural identity

Operating as a vital lakefront terminus on Silk Road caravans, Tatvan prospered near Nemrut volcano. Known historically as a vital Lake Van ferry and trading port, Tatvan blossomed in the 20th century into Lake Van's absolute premier resort metropolis, watersports capital, and trans-Asian railway ferry terminus.

Frequently asked questions

What makes Tatvan a premier tourism destination in Eastern Anatolia?+

Tatvan combines sparkling Lake Van resort beaches with gateway access to the majestic Nemrut Crater Lake caldera and trans-Asian railway heritage.

How do visitors access Nemrut Krater Gölü from Tatvan?+

Scenic mountain roads wind upward from Tatvan directly to the rim of the Nemrut volcanic crater caldera in 30 minutes.

How far is Tatvan from Central Bitlis and Ahlat?+

Tatvan is located 25 kilometers (a 20-minute drive) east of central Bitlis and 40 kilometers southwest of Ahlat along the lake highway.
